Aakash Shah is the founder of Wyndly, a startup that helps people permanently fix their allergies from home. Aakash came up with the idea as a result of suffering from allergies during covid19 lockdowns when cooped up at home with his family cats. This led him to co-found Wyndly with his cousin, Dr. Manan Shah, in 2020 as well as go through Y Combinator as part of the W21 batch. Before Wyndly, Aakash worked on growth across a number of startups.
